The Parañaque City government said seven animal bite treatment centers and the Ospital ng Parañaque (OsPar)-1 are giving free anti-rabies vaccination to residents who suffered from bites or scratches from dogs and cats. ManilaBulletin

Mayor Eric Olivarez advised residents to visit the seven animal bite treatment centers and OsPar-1 for their vaccination once they get bitten by dogs and cats, including mere scratches, following the reported increase of rabies cases in the city.

Olivarez said the animal bite treatment centers are located in the following barangay health centers -- La Huerta Center with schedule every Tuesday, Thursday and Friday from 1:00 p.m. to 3:00 p.m.; San Isidro Health Center every Tuesday and Friday from 1:00 p.m.- 3:00 p.m.; BF Homes Health Center every Monday and Thursday from 10:00 a.m. – 12:00 noon and Sun Valley Health Center every Monday, Tuesday and Friday from 9:00 a.m.-12 noon.

He said the other animal bite treatment centers are located in San Martin de Porres Health Center every Monday and Thursday from 9:00 a.m.-11:00 a.m.; Don Bosco Health Center every Monday and Thursday from 1:00 p.m.-3:00 p.m.; San Antonio Health Center every Monday, Tuesday and Friday from 9:00 a.m.-12:00 noon and also in the afternoon at 1:00p.m. to 2:00 p.m., and at OsPar-1 located along Baragay La Huerta which accepts patients of animal bites from Tuesday to Friday from 8:00 a.m.-5:00 p.m.
